    F/X (1986)

    Share
    Facebook Twitter Pinterest WhatsApp Reddit Email

    F/X offers a different twist on the run-of-the-mill homicide movie as special effects are the key ingredient of the plot.

    The special effects are the main trade of the movie’s central character, Roland “Rollie” Tyler (Bryan Brown), who is billed as the best SFX man in the business. It is his trade, however, that gets him into trouble.

    Tyler is approached by Martin Lipton (Cliff De Young), a federal agent associated with the Witness Protection Program who wants Rollie to stage a mock killing of ageing mobster Nicholas DeFranco (Jerry Orbach) and make it real enough with special effects to leave everyone thinking the gangster is really dead.

    DeFranco can then safely tell all he knows and finger all his cohorts before living the rest of his life without worry in another part of the nation with a new identity provided by the feds.

    Tyler initially hesitates to accept the challenge and $30,000 payment but reconsiders when thinking about the challenge it would create. He finally agrees.

    Rollie quickly and painstakingly sets up the mock murder by carefully fitting the federal snitch with hidden squibs that will create bullet holes and ooze out blood.

    The stage is set in a small Italian restaurant where DeFranco will be gunned down in front of a crowd of people.

    Rollie enters the restaurant and empties his gun of blanks at the mobster, who crashes to the floor in a bloody mess.

    After leaving the restaurant, Tyler is whisked away by Lipton and his driver. The agent apologises to Tyer and then pulls out a gun and tries to shoot him. The feds don’t want any loose ends.

    Tyler narrowly escapes after the car crashes into a building.

    He is now a hunted man and doesn’t know if his staged “hit” was real or make-believe. He uses his unique brand of tricks to trip them up, track them down and have them and their plans go bust.

    F/X is a good action movie and – naturally – has excellent special effects. Bryan Brown’s performance is good, and he is supported by the fine acting of Brian Dennehy as a messy, unkempt police detective and Mason Adam as the crooked head fed setting up the bogus hit on the mobster.

    FIREBALL XL-5 begins this Saturday, 3rd June at 2:35pm on #TalkingPicturesTV So here's five fascinating facts about the Gerry Anderson's 'Supermarionation' programme!
    1 - The series was inspired by the 'space race' between the USSR and the USA. 2 - 39 episodes were made in black and white. 3 - The series premiered on ATV London in October 1962. 4 - The voice of Steve Zodiac was provided by actor Paul Maxwell. 5 - The famous theme song was sung by Don Spencer.
